Last Thursday’s special screening of the 10-part docu-series America to Me at Howard University prompted a much needed conversation about race and equity in America’s public schools. John B. King Jr. gave opening remarks and joined a panel discussion with Interim Chancellor of the District of Columbia Public Schools, Amanda Alexander; National Black Justice Coalition Executive Director, David Johns; former Washington, D.C., Deputy Mayor for Education, Abigail Smith; and a student featured in the series, Jada Buford.
